Glove? He don't need no stinking glove.

A minor issue like losing his glove won't stop Waterloo Black Hawks goaltender Stephon Williams from making a tremendous save. In his team's USHL playoff game against the Lincoln Stars, Williams saved 29 of 31 shots, but none more impressive than this one. On a shot by Stars’ Kevin Roy, the quick-witted keeper lost his glove, but still snagged the puck from going into the goal with his cold, bare hand. Williams and the Black Hawks coasted to a 6-2 victory, which won the series and punched their ticket to the Clark Cup Final.
